A tragic and shocking crime unfolded on a crowded Brooklyn street when Claudia Banton, 46, gunned down her childhood friend, Delia Johnson, in a cold-blooded act of violence. The motive behind the murder remains a mystery, even as Banton was sentenced to 23 years-to-life in prison.
During the sentencing in Brooklyn Supreme Court, Johnson’s grieving relatives expressed their anguish and disbelief at the heinous crime committed by someone they once considered family. Johnson’s brother, Mathis Lemons, stated that Banton showed “no remorse” for her actions and deserved to spend the rest of her life behind bars for the “evil act” she committed.
Banton, who remained emotionless throughout the proceedings, was convicted of second-degree murder and second-degree criminal possession of a weapon for the brutal execution-style killing that took place outside a friend’s funeral in Crown Heights on August 4, 2021. Despite the fact that Banton and Johnson were former friends, no information regarding the motive for the murder was revealed during the trial.
The prosecution described how Banton shot Johnson at least five times in front of shocked onlookers, with witnesses fleeing in fear as the shots rang out. The chilling police bodycam footage shown during the trial captured Johnson gasping for air as she lay wounded on the ground, her life slipping away before their eyes. Surveillance footage also captured the brutal slaying, providing irrefutable evidence of Banton’s crime.
After initially being stopped by police in her white Mercedes following the shooting, Banton was released when witnesses mistakenly identified the shooter as a man. It wasn’t until three months later, when US Marshals tracked her down in Jacksonville, Florida, that Banton was apprehended. She had altered her appearance and deleted her social media in an attempt to evade capture.
